Job Description

The Occupational Therapist will be responsible for delivering specialized, patient-centered therapeutic care. Key duties will include:

  • Assessing the needs of patients across various age groups with physical, developmental, or emotional disabilities.
  • Developing and implementing individualized treatment plans aimed at restoring or enhancing patients' daily functional skills, including self-care, work, and leisure activities.
  • Utilizing specialized therapeutic techniques and activities to improve strength, motor coordination, endurance, and cognition.
  • Educating patients, their families, and caregivers on coping strategies and the use of adaptive equipment.
  • Collaborating closely with a multidisciplinary team including doctors, nurses, physiotherapists, and speech therapists to provide holistic care.
  • Accurately documenting patient progress and maintaining medical records in compliance with the highest professional standards and institutional policies.
  • Participating in community outreach programs and educational workshops related to health and wellness.

Requirements and Qualifications

To qualify for this role, you must meet the following criteria:

  • Educational Qualification: A Bachelor's degree in Occupational Therapy from a recognized university. A Master's degree is a distinct advantage.
  • Licensing: Must possess a valid license to practice as an Occupational Therapist from the Omani authorities, or be eligible to obtain one. Eligibility typically involves recognition of your qualification and relevant experience.
  • Experience: Proven practical experience of at least 2-3 years in Occupational Therapy, preferably in a hospital, rehabilitation center, or multi-disciplinary clinic setting.
  • Personal Skills:
    •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ills for interacting with patients and colleagues.
    • Empathy, patience, and a strong ability to motivate others.
    • Strong analytical skills for case assessment and progress monitoring.
    • Ability to work independently and as part of a cohesive team.
    • Flexibility and adaptability in a fast-paced work environment.
  • Technical Requirements: Proficiency in using modern therapeutic equipment and tools, and competence in computer software for medical records.
  • Language: Proficiency in English for documentation and communication within the international team. Knowledge of Arabic is a significant advantage for interacting with local patients.
